If you started mountain biking in San Diego you pro'ly flirted with local trails like Spring Canyon and Daily Ranch. Then one day you raod Noble, your first "real" trail. That was the day you became a Man or Woman (in a mtb sense). Noble is not the longest or crazyest trail but for San Diegans there is somthing about this trail. So if you feel like you popped your mtb cherry on Noble Canyon, this badge is for you.
